Servo Machine Features

High-Response Servo System

Precision encoder and proportional valve enable real-time closed-loop control of injection speed and pressure. Improves response time by over 40% vs. traditional systems, enhancing repeatability and shot consistency.

Energy Efficiency up to 70%

Patented servo power-saving system (Patent M327493, M328970) reduces energy consumption and lowers operating costs.


Low-Noise Operation

Servo-driven control reduces mechanical noise during movement, enabling quieter production and a more operator-friendly workspace.

Optimized Hydraulic Circuit

Built-in sensors and smart PID tuning reduce oil temperature and boost actuator responsiveness — ideal for precision molding in optical and medical applications.


Servo vs. Hydraulic vs. Electric

Machine Type Comparison

Feature Hydraulic Servo-Hydraulic (HRS/HRFC) All-Electric
Energy Saving ★☆☆ ★★★ ★★★★
Injection Precision ★★☆ ★★★★ ★★★★★
Maintenance High Medium Low
Cost Low Moderate High
Material Flexibility Wide Wide Moderate

Applications & Industry Benefits

  • Automotive: Rearview mirror housings, interior trim panels, dashboard components, air vent louvers, pillar covers, and functional clips.
  • Electronics: USB casings, LED light bases, battery compartments, plastic brackets for PCBs, and small switch housings.
  • Packaging: Caps, flip-top lids, food containers, dosing pumps, and medical packaging.
  • Consumer Goods: Toothbrush handles, cosmetic cases, appliance knobs, personal care dispensers, and household plastic parts.
